2014 Toyota Tundra appears with revised styling, same mechanicals
Thu, 07 Feb 2013Toyota has pulled the curtain back on its 2014 Tundra, showing a truck that has gotten its most significant refresh since its launch as a 2007 model. For better or worse, however, the changes that Toyota has made to the fullsize pickup are mostly cosmetic, with the underpinnings of the vehicle staying unchanged.
The most obvious revision for 2014 is to the bluff front fascia of the truck. There's a new, taller squared-off grille decorating the Tundra's nose, along with a revised, three-part front bumper design. The optional black grille-frame strikes us as an acquired taste, to say the least, but other models, like the Limited above, is all clad in chrome. Fenders and wheel wells are more square than in the out-going truck, too. Perhaps most significant is the revised bed design, which Toyota calls "all-new," with new sheet metal on the sides, a revised tailgate and a very subtle integrated spoiler.
Inside, Toyota has given buyers some new seats and a new-look instrument panel. A backup camera (always handy on big trucks) is now standard equipment on all grades, as is Bluetooth connectivity. Blind spot monitoring is a new, optional feature as well. In all, as with the exterior mods, the changes in-cabin are far more evolutionary than revolutionary.
Which of these five plug-ins should win the 2017 Green Car of the Year?
Tue, Nov 8 2016It's going to be a competitive race for the 2017 Green Car Of The Year. With a minivan in the running for the first time in ages, the five finalists announced by Green Car Journal today include five very different plug-in vehicles. As Ron Cogan, the editor and publisher of Green Car Journal, said in a statement, "electrification is now considered by most automakers an essential technology for current and future high-efficiency models." Let's check out the list: Toyota Prius Prime, the updated plug-in version of the world's best-selling hybrid. Chevy Bolt, GM's all-new entry into the long-range EV game. Chrysler Pacifica, a family hauler with the ability to go 30 miles on electric power. Kia Optima. The nomination is for the full line-up, but really the hybrid and plug-in hybrid models are the green stars here. BMW 330e iPerformance, one of the automaker's many new plug-in hybrids that bring battery power to models outside the i sub-brand. Green Car Journal will announce the winners at the Los Angeles Auto Show on November 17th, along with some, "other green transportation announcements," whatever that means. Last year, the winner was the 2016 Chevy Volt, the first model to snatch up two wins. Which do you think should win this year? 100-year-old Yellowstone ranger station now powered by Camry Hybrid batteries [w/video]
Thu, May 14 2015With a new project, Toyota is bringing power to the prairie and finding a way to reuse nickel-metal hydride batteries at the same time. The automaker recently completed assisting Yellowstone National Park's installation of a solar power station at the Lamar Buffalo Ranch to electrify the ranger station and education center there for the first time. Toyota's major part in the system is an array of 208 batteries that are repurposed from old Camry Hybrid sedans, and they can store 85 kilowatt-hours of energy at a time. That's as much as one 85-kWh battery pack from one top-of-the-line Tesla Model S. Toyota figures that the whole setup should generate enough annual electricity for six average US homes, which is plenty for the ranch. For a constant source of power, the site plans to install a micro-hydro turbine in a nearby stream in 2016. Prior to creating the wall of batteries to store all of this energy, Toyota disassembled and tested each one. It also installed a new management system on them to maximize their lifespan. Toyota Flips the Switch to Sustainable Power at Yellowstone National Park Lamar Buffalo Ranch Renewable, Zero Emission Energy System Is Now Online System Features 208 Re-used Camry Hybrid Batteries May 12, 2015 Torrance, Calif. (May 12, 2015) – The lights are on where the buffalo roam. At the Lamar Buffalo Ranch field campus in Yellowstone National Park, an innovative distributed energy system that combines solar power generation with re-used Camry Hybrid battery packs is now online. The result: reliable, sustainable, zero emission power to the ranger station and education center for the first time since it was founded in 1907. Announced in June 2014, the partnership among Toyota, Indy Power Systems, Sharp USA SolarWorld, Patriot Solar, National Park Service and Yellowstone Park Foundation is an innovative effort to extend the useful life of hybrid vehicle batteries while providing sustainable power generation for one of the most remote, pristine areas in the United States. Solar panels generate the renewable electricity stored within the 208 used Camry Hybrid nickel-metal hydride battery packs, recovered from Toyota dealers across the United States.
